Students' Projects - Grade 6

Image
During my School Internship, I was handling grades 6 and 9. In the grade 6 textbook, there is a lesson titled 'Trip to Ooty' which is an anecdote of a group of school students going on a school excursion in the Ooty Toy Train.  After I finished teaching the lesson, I had asked the students to make models of the Toy Train using whatever resources they had. Many students had contributed to it out of which two were outstanding. One was a boy who made a large model of the train using many different carton boxes, while the other one was that of a boy who made a smaller one, but more of a working model. In fact, his model operated on the principle of repulsion between two magnets which was quite commendable at that age to achieve.

Visit to the Regional Science Center - Coimbatore

Image
 On the 27th of August, we, the second year students of Dr.G.R.Damodaran College of Education, paid a visit to the Regional Science Center, Coimbatore. It was, indeed, a great experience for us as we learnt a lot of things through the visit. In fact, we even learnt the mechanism behind some of the most basic things we use on a daily basis, such as, wheels, zip, etc. There were four sections: First, a handloom section where life-like mannequins of looms and weavers were displayed; second, a section filled with astronomical displays and explanations; third, a series of button-operated instruments; fourth, a section called 'How things work' in which they mechanism behind everyday things were explained. There was a 3D-theatre, too. On the whole, the entire visit was informative and interesting.
